All Purpose Rust Inhibitive Metal Primer

Product Data Sheet
DescriptionAN INTERIOR/EXTERIOR PIGMENTED MEDIUM/LONG ALYKD METAL PRIMER
708195x Red Oxide
Basic UseA high solids material designed for priming all exterior or interior ferrous metal surfaces such as structural steel, bridges, tanks, towers, piping, sash and trim metal doors and frames, ornamental iron, gutters, fire escapes and miscellaneous metal objects. Rust inhibitive pigment resists formation of rust, thus preserving the metal as well as the integrity of finishing coats. Flexible film expands and contracts with the substrate to maintain excellent adhesion.

Prep & Prime
Surfaces must be clean, dry, and free of contaminants such as wax, oils, grease, weld splatter, loose mil, scale, rust. As a minimum SSPC-SPC Hand Tool Cleaning or SSPC-SPC3 Machine Tool Cleaning is recommended for interior exposure. Smooth surfaces should be abraded to enhance adhesion. Improved performance can be achieved with and SSPC-SPC6 Commercial Blast. All surfaces prepared for painting should be coated within 8 hours of completion of surface prep.
MetalSurfaces to be primed must be thoroughly cleaned of all foreign material by sandblasting, wire brushing, wheel abrading, etc. All grease, cutting oil, etc., must be removed prior to priming. For best results prime metal immediately after cleaning.
Application
Do not apply when air or surface temperatures are expected to drop below 50 degrees F. or rise above 95 degrees F. during application and drying.
